How to do lever hammer grip preacher curl

  1. Adjust the seat height and position yourself on the leverage machine.

  2. Place your upper arms on the preacher pad, ensuring your chest is pressed against it.

  3. Grasp the handles with a hammer grip (palms facing each other).

  4. Keeping your upper arms stationary, exhale and curl the handles towards your shoulders.

  5. Pause for a moment at the top, squeezing your biceps.

  6. Inhale and slowly lower the handles back to the starting position.

  7. Repeat for the desired number of repetitions.
